The 38th Biathlon World Championships took place from March 15 to 23, 2003 in Khanty-Mansiysk , Russia .

For the first time at world championships, the women's relay was only held over a distance of 4 × 6 km. There was another novelty in the women's pursuit race, for the first time two gold medals were awarded in a competition at a World Cup after a winner could not be determined beyond doubt based on the photo of the finish line.

In 2002, because of the Winter Olympics in Salt Lake City, there had only been the world championships in the non-Olympic mass start.

After the tightest World Cup decision of all time, Martina Glagow worked to ensure that Sandrine Bailly also received the gold medal after she had initially been declared the sole winner.
